Lv 15:32 Ista est lex eius, qui patitur fluxum seminis, et qui polluitur coitu,
This is the law of him, who suffers a flow of semen, and of him who is defiled by intercourse,

Syntax
Predicate Statement: Ista est lex introduces a formal legal definition.
Possessive Genitive: eius specifies the person to whom the law applies.
First Relative Clause: qui patitur fluxum seminis identifies the first condition.
Coordinated Relative Clause: et qui polluitur coitu adds a second, parallel condition.
Morphology
- Ista — Lemma: iste; Part of Speech: demonstrative adjective; Form: nominative singular feminine; Function: modifies lex; Translation: this; Notes: Points to the immediately following regulation.
- est — Lemma: sum; Part of Speech: verb; Form: third person singular present indicative active; Function: copula; Translation: is; Notes: Establishes definition.
- lex — Lemma: lex; Part of Speech: noun; Form: nominative singular feminine; Function: subject; Translation: law; Notes: Refers to binding ritual instruction.
- eius — Lemma: is; Part of Speech: possessive pronoun; Form: genitive singular masculine; Function: dependent genitive; Translation: of him; Notes: Specifies the individual concerned.
- qui — Lemma: qui; Part of Speech: relative pronoun; Form: nominative singular masculine; Function: subject of relative clause; Translation: who; Notes: Introduces defining condition.
- patitur — Lemma: patior; Part of Speech: verb; Form: third person singular present indicative deponent; Function: verb of relative clause; Translation: suffers; Notes: Deponent verb with active meaning.
- fluxum — Lemma: fluxus; Part of Speech: noun; Form: accusative singular masculine; Function: direct object; Translation: flow; Notes: Physical discharge in view.
- seminis — Lemma: semen; Part of Speech: noun; Form: genitive singular neuter; Function: dependent genitive; Translation: of semen; Notes: Specifies the nature of the flow.
- et — Lemma: et; Part of Speech: conjunction; Form: invariable; Function: coordination; Translation: and; Notes: Joins parallel cases.
- qui — Lemma: qui; Part of Speech: relative pronoun; Form: nominative singular masculine; Function: subject of relative clause; Translation: who; Notes: Introduces second defining condition.
- polluitur — Lemma: polluo; Part of Speech: verb; Form: third person singular present indicative passive; Function: verb of relative clause; Translation: is defiled; Notes: Passive emphasizes resulting state.
- coitu — Lemma: coitus; Part of Speech: noun; Form: ablative singular masculine; Function: ablative of means or cause; Translation: by intercourse; Notes: Specifies the cause of defilement.
